Expression and clinical significance of miR-141 in childhood B-cell acute lymphoblastic leukemia / 中国癌症杂志

ABSTRACT
Background and

purpose:

MicroRNAs are 19 to 25-nucleotide noncoding RNA molecules. The aim of this article was to investigate the expression and clinical signiifcance of microRNA-141 in childhood B-cell acute lymphoblastic leukemia (ALL).

Methods:

Bone marrow samples were collected from 35 children with B-cell ALL and 15 children with non hematologic disease. Total RNA was acquired from bone marrow. Real-time PCR was performed to detect the expression level of miR-141.

Results:

The relative expression level of miR-141 in B-cell ALL group was remarkably lower than those in the control (P<0.05). The expression of miR-141 in newly diagnosed samples was lower than those in Day 30 and Week 12 samples respectively (P<0.05). Besides, the expression of miR-141 in Day 30 samples was lower than those in week 12 samples (P<0.05). The expression of miR-141 in children over 10 years old was signiifcantly lower than those in children under 10 years old (P<0.05). The expression of miR-141 in low-risk group was higher than those in mid-risk and high-risk group respectively (P<0.05), and there was signiifcant difference between mid-risk and high-risk groups (P<0.05).

Conclusion:

MiR-141 is likely to have tumor suppressor effect and to be a potential prognostic biomarker in childhood B cell ALL.
